About Exile Art Collective
Exile Art Collective is a private, selective tattoo studio in Austin, Texas, run by Andrés Acosta. Work here runs toward realism, color, and portrait tattooing, with a fine-art approach that leans into surreal realism, cosmic imagery, floral morphs (their Rosemorphs), scar work, and large-scale custom pieces. Andrés brings 17 years behind the machine and works as an educator as well.
This is an appointment-only studio built around custom design work and consultations, so plan on booking ahead rather than walking in. The guiding idea, in Andrés's own words, is that tattooing is fine art on a living canvas.
